Abstract
A system, method and computer program product are disclosed for reducing costs in a supply chain management framework. Data is received from a plurality of supply chain participants utilizing a network. The received data relates to the sale of products by the supply chain participants. Rules are determined to ensure the incurrence of minimal costs to the supply chain participants and the rules are applied to ensure supply to the supply chain participants at minimal cost without requiring the supply chain manager to take title to any goods.
